Fingernail fungus is an infection that can be there to any human being who is not paying much attention to his/her nails. The fungus attack is not at all painful but it looks unattractive to have crumbled nails. Due to this the color of the nail changes to black, yellow or white. The nails grows back deformed and in the advanced stages it even has a foul odor. The toenail fungus is because of the most common infection, Dermatophytes and in the case of fingernail fungus it is yeast.
